Output 9337077109ecf2a6f3a2a4f8b42cccb2b8d6b044ad355c26e5e8c2f9f2d67239:1

value
17418167
script pubkey
OP_0 OP_PUSHBYTES_20 3404d906e60de59fd5485d9302b7bb3bdf883a7c
address
bc1qxszdjphxphjel42gtkfs9dam800cswnudfmj2r
transaction
9337077109ecf2a6f3a2a4f8b42cccb2b8d6b044ad355c26e5e8c2f9f2d67239
spent
true